Your plumbing system, while designed to be efficient, is a complex network susceptible to various blockages. In a residential setting like Val Vista Lakes, certain habits and environmental factors contribute significantly to the frequency and severity of drain clogs. Recognizing these causes is the first step towards proactive maintenance and timely intervention.

Hair and Soap Scum: The Bedroom and Bathroom Culprits

In your bathrooms, the primary culprits are typically a combination of hair and soap scum. Showers and bathtub drains are particularly prone to this. Over time, accumulated hair, especially long strands, can catch on imperfections within the pipes. When combined with soap, which contains fats and oils, this hair forms a sticky, cohesive mass that gradually constricts the drain’s opening.

  • Kitchen Sink Woes: Grease, Fat, and Food Debris

Your kitchen sink faces a different set of challenges. Pouring grease, fats, and oils down the drain, even after rinsing with hot water, is a recipe for disaster. These substances solidify as they cool within the pipes, creating stubborn blockages. This is particularly relevant in Val Vista Lakes where family meals and cooking are common. Even small food particles, when repeatedly washed down, can accumulate and combine with other debris to form significant clogs.

  • The Role of Foreign Objects

Accidents happen, and sometimes small objects find their way into drains. This can include children’s toys, jewelry, cotton swabs, or even feminine hygiene products. These items can lodge themselves in the pipework, creating immediate blockages or acting as anchors for other accumulating debris.

Mineral Buildup and Hard Water Effects

Gilbert, like much of Arizona, experiences hard water. This means your water supply contains a higher concentration of dissolved minerals, primarily calcium and magnesium. While not directly forming clogs like grease or hair, hard water contributes to mineral buildup within your pipes. Over time, these mineral deposits can harden and narrow the internal diameter of your pipes, making them more susceptible to clogs from other sources.

Aging Plumbing Infrastructure: A Factor to Consider

While Val Vista Lakes is a developed community, the age of your home’s plumbing can play a role. Older pipes, especially those made from materials like cast iron, can corrode over time, developing rough internal surfaces. These rough patches provide ideal sites for hair, grease, and other debris to adhere, initiating the clog formation process. Even if your home is relatively new, the municipal infrastructure in your area might be older, and issues at that level can sometimes impact your home’s drainage.

Recognizing the Signs of a Clogged Drain in Your Val Vista Lakes Home

When your drains aren’t performing as expected, it’s crucial to recognize the tell-tale signs. Ignoring these indicators can lead to more significant plumbing problems, including water damage and sewage backups. Being observant of your plumbing’s behavior is key to timely intervention.

Slow Draining: The Most Common Indicator

The most obvious sign of a developing clog is a drain that empties slowly. You might notice water pooling in the sink, shower, or bathtub for an extended period after use. This sluggishness indicates that the water is encountering resistance as it tries to flow through the pipes.

Slow Shower Drains

After a shower, if you find yourself standing in an inch or two of water that takes a considerable amount of time to recede, your shower drain likely has a partial blockage. This is a common issue, especially with the combined effects of hair and soap in the shampoo and conditioner you use.

Slow Sink Drains

Similarly, a kitchen or bathroom sink that drains slowly after use, leaving standing water, points to an obstruction in the pipework. You might need to wait several minutes for the water to disappear completely.

Gurgling Sounds: A Verbal Warning

Unusual gurgling or bubbling sounds coming from your drains, particularly when other fixtures are in use, are often an indication of escaping air. This air should ideally be flowing unimpeded through your plumbing system. When a clog is present, air is forced back up through the partially blocked pipe, creating these disconcerting noises. This can be heard in sinks, toilets, or even from floor drains.

Foul Odors Emanating from Drains

A persistent, unpleasant odor emanating from a drain is a strong indicator of trapped organic matter that is beginning to decompose. This organic material, often a combination of food scraps, hair, and soap scum, breaks down within the pipes, releasing foul-smelling gases. In a neighborhood like Val Vista Lakes, where outdoor living is common, these odors can be particularly unwelcome.

Complete Blockage or Water Backups

The most severe sign of a drain clog is a complete blockage, where water refuses to drain at all, or worse, begins to back up into other fixtures. If flushing your toilet causes water to rise in your shower, or if running your washing machine results in water backing up into your kitchen sink, you have a significant plumbing issue on your hands that requires immediate attention.

DIY Drain Cleaning Techniques for Val Vista Lakes Residents

While professional drain cleaning services offer comprehensive solutions, there are several effective DIY methods you can employ for minor to moderate clogs within your Val Vista Lakes home. These techniques can save you time and money, but it’s important to use them cautiously to avoid damaging your plumbing.

The Plunger: A Classic Solution

A common and often effective tool for clearing clogs is a plunger. Ensure you have the right type of plunger for the job – a cup plunger for sinks and tubs, and a flange plunger for toilets.

  • Proper Plunger Technique

To effectively use a plunger, you need to create a seal around the drain. For sinks and tubs, ensure there’s enough water in the fixture to cover the bell of the plunger. For toilets, the plunger should be submerged in water. Place the plunger firmly over the drain opening and give it a series of vigorous up-and-down thrusts. The suction and pressure created can dislodge many common clogs. After several plunges, remove the plunger and see if the water drains. Repeat if necessary.

Boiling Water and Dish Soap: A Gentle Approach

For clogs in kitchen sinks, particularly those caused by grease, boiling water can be surprisingly effective.

  • Kitchen Sink Grease Removal

Carefully pour a pot of boiling water directly down the drain. Let it sit for a few minutes to help break down solidified grease. You can also add a squirt of liquid dish soap before the boiling water, as dish soap is designed to cut through grease. This method is best for minor grease buildup and should not be used on PVC pipes if you have concerns about extreme heat.

The Baking Soda and Vinegar Method: A Natural Effervescent Solution

The chemical reaction between baking soda and vinegar can create a fizzing action that helps to loosen and break down clogs.

  • Bathroom and Kitchen Drain Application

Pour about half a cup of baking soda down the drain, followed by an equal amount of white vinegar. The mixture will begin to fizz. Cover the drain with a stopper or a rag to contain the reaction and allow it to work for at least 30 minutes, or even overnight for tougher clogs. After the waiting period, flush the drain with hot water. This method is safe for most plumbing systems.

The Drain Snake or Auger: For Deeper Obstructions

If the above methods fail, a drain snake (also known as a plumber’s auger) can reach deeper into the pipes to dislodge clogs.

  • Operating a Manual Drain Snake

These tools are typically a flexible metal cable with a handle. You insert the end of the snake into the drain and feed it into the pipe until you encounter resistance, which is likely the clog. Once you feel the clog, you can rotate the handle to either break up the obstruction or hook onto it to pull it out. Be gentle to avoid damaging your pipes.

When to Call a Professional Drain Cleaning Service in Val Vista Lakes

While DIY methods are useful, there are situations where professional intervention is not just recommended, but essential. Attempting to tackle severe clogs with improper tools or techniques can lead to more serious damage, resulting in higher repair costs.

Persistent and Recurring Clogs

If you find yourself frequently dealing with clogged drains, even after using DIY methods, it’s a sign of a more significant underlying issue. This could indicate a problem further down the line in your main sewer line, or a buildup of extensive corrosion or debris that you cannot reach with home tools.

Main Sewer Line Blockages

Clogs in the main sewer line that serves your entire house are a serious concern. These typically manifest as multiple drains backing up simultaneously, or sewage backing up into your home. This requires professional equipment and expertise to diagnose and clear.

Roots Intrusion in Pipes

Especially in established neighborhoods like Val Vista Lakes, tree roots can penetrate underground sewer lines, causing blockages. These are difficult for DIY methods to address and require specialized root-cutting equipment from a professional plumbing service.

Suspected Damage to Plumbing

If you notice any signs of damage to your pipes, such as leaks, corrosion, or sagging sections, it’s imperative to call a professional immediately. Attempting to force a clog through damaged pipes can cause them to burst, leading to significant water damage.

Lack of Success with DIY Methods

If you’ve tried the common DIY solutions and none of them have worked to clear the clog, it’s time to admit defeat and call in the experts. Professionals have access to a range of advanced tools and techniques, including video pipe inspection, which can accurately diagnose the exact nature and location of the blockage.

Preventive Maintenance for Your Val Vista Lakes Drains

The most effective approach to drain cleaning is prevention. By adopting good plumbing habits and performing regular maintenance, you can significantly reduce the likelihood of experiencing inconvenient and costly clogs in your Val Vista Lakes home.

Responsible Disposal of Kitchen Waste

  • Avoid Pouring Grease and Oils Down the Drain

As mentioned previously, this is a cardinal rule. Collect grease and oils in a disposable container and discard them in your regular trash.

  • Use a Sink Strainer

Install a good quality sink strainer in your kitchen sink to catch food particles and prevent them from entering the drain. Empty the strainer regularly.

  • Scrape Plates Before Washing

Before rinsing dishes, scrape any remaining food scraps into the trash or compost bin.

Bathroom Habits for Clear Drains

  • Use Hair Catchers in Showers and Tubs

These inexpensive devices can significantly reduce the amount of hair that goes down the drain. Clean them out after each use.

  • Be Mindful of What Goes Down the Toilet

Only flush toilet paper and human waste. Feminine hygiene products, cotton swabs, and wipes should always be disposed of in the trash.

Periodic Professional Plumbing Inspections

Even if you don’t have immediate concerns, consider scheduling periodic plumbing inspections with a reputable service in the Gilbert area. A professional can identify potential issues before they become major problems.

Video Pipe Inspections

A professional can use a camera to inspect the inside of your pipes, identifying potential areas of buildup, corrosion, or intrusion before they cause a blockage.

Routine Drain Flushing

Some plumbing services offer routine drain flushing services that can help to clear out minor buildup before it becomes a significant clog.
